			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://www.thelampnyc.org/resources/"><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-2113" title="lamplit logo" src="http://www.thelampnyc.org/wp-content/uploads/lamplit-logo-300x88.jpg" alt="" width="323" height="95" /></a>Ofcom yesterday released the <a href="http://consumers.ofcom.org.uk/2011/10/children-and-parents-media-use-attitudes/" target="_blank">results of a study</a> which found that 54% of parents with children between the ages of 5 and 15 supervise what their kids are doing online. This is a jump from 48% in 2010. Bravo, UK parents!</p>
<p>However, the ways in which parents supervise their children can vary a great deal. There is a huge difference between blocking pornography sites on the family computer, and installing spyware recording your child&#8217;s every keystroke. While it is great that more parents are getting involved with what their children are doing online, it&#8217;s also important to remember that the methods parents use to supervise are critical. Kids need to know they can talk to their parents, even when they make mistakes. Parents need to understand how and why their children use new media, and both sides of the equation need to agree on sets of boundaries for things like privacy and screen time.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The LAMP has added another LAMPlit resource guide to its library! <a href="http://www.thelampnyc.org/resources/" target="_blank"><em>Check out the news!</em></a> is written by Katherine Fry, Ph.D., Education Director and Professor of Media Studies at Brooklyn College. Dr. Fry has spent years studying news literacy, and recently <a href="http://www.thelampnyc.org/2009/11/09/news-from-the-lamp-our-november-illuminations-newsletter/" target="_blank">has been traveling to conferences</a> to speak on the subject to other communications professionals.</p>
<p>So, what is news literacy? It&#8217;s the ability to think critically about the news, and the way you find out about what is reported in the world around you. It helps you form your own opinions, and become a more active media consumer. Instead of believing whatever a news outlet tells you, you&#8217;ll be thinking for yourself about how, why and where you get the news that shapes your life and your everyday decisions. <div><span style="color: #000000; font-family: Century Gothic,ITC Avant Garde,Arial,Helvetica,sans-serif; font-size: xx-small;"><strong>Summer Plans:</strong> This summer I&#8217;m doing a bunch of things. 1) I&#8217;m now teaching a summer course at Hofstra, while 2) writing a report for the <a href="http://rs6.net/tn.jsp?et=1102595060648&amp;s=241&amp;e=001BmQfbIl9axdwXTsfUAgphUiSe_sh5KlkhF6RnI95sXi7c6pbKbsxj0pFLNppELeO6Cy9ejj0OwJ4_gv5NOafoOhzx_zdR9vagRdoIcP9Y0Q=" target="_blank"><span style="color: #000099;">National Endowment for Democracy</span></a> (NED) on Media Literacy and Youth. The report surveys existing media literacy initiatives in the US and globally, and makes recommendations for how funding organizations can<br />
better support Media Literacy initiatives worldwide. After the report is finished, I&#8217;ll be 3) traveling to Mexico City (hopefully&#8230;) as a guest scholar at <a href="http://rs6.net/tn.jsp?et=1102595060648&amp;s=241&amp;e=001BmQfbIl9axfS5KHVQMWk-OHf6GiDZBdn4FKVgiO6asIEHktDdtR0cN0AgFNDV8SOcEdQ4GBPC7Cjju22gB-vci3TAR_6CnkBYM3m00qxRtM=" target="_blank"><span style="color: #000099;">Iberoamericana University</span></a>, where I&#8217;ll be teaching a graduate seminar and meeting with the Iberoamericana faculty to discuss various<br />
possible research initiatives. Once I&#8217;m back, I&#8217;m getting 4) married! on July 18th. Then on July 25th 5) my wife and I are heading to Salzburg, Austria for one month, where I am the Director of a global media program called the Salzburg Academy on Media &amp; Global Change. The program gathers over 50 students and 10 faculty from all over the world to<br />
explore media&#8217;s role in global society. So it&#8217;s a busy but productive summer to say the least&#8230;<br />
<strong>How are you involved with the IFC Media Project?</strong> I&#8217;m the creator of the 5A&#8217;s of Media Literacy Framework, used by IFC in conjunction with it&#8217;s Media Project initiative, MakeMediaMatter. IFC wanted to launch a pro-social initiative around Media Literacy to help empower young media makers to understand the influence their production will have on individuals, communities and society. They found my work, and we began to have discussions as to ways we could build a site that would help youth and young adults reflect on their media use and production. They used  the 5A&#8217;s framework-Access, Awareness, Assessment, Appreciation, Action-to launch this initiative. We&#8217;ve been involved in panels, discussions, we&#8217;re writing regularly for the blog, etc. It&#8217;s been a   great collaboration so far.</span></div>
<div><span style="color: #000000; font-family: Century Gothic,ITC Avant Garde,Arial,Helvetica,sans-serif; font-size: xx-small;"><strong>What is your favorite part of teaching media studies?</strong> My favorite part of media studies is helping students look at the media they spend so much time with daily from a new angle. Media studies is a subject that remains forever fresh. It&#8217;s something students can engage with, and it&#8217;s my job to make them see the connections between media use, their role as<br />
individuals in community, and democracy. I always start my courses by stating: &#8220;Anything you don&#8217;t see with your own two eyes comes from a mediated source of information.&#8221; That simple premise is the jumping off point for some interesting, relevant, and  current discussions!</span></div>

<div><span style="color: #000000; font-family: Century Gothic,ITC Avant Garde,Arial,Helvetica,sans-serif; font-size: xx-small;"><img src="http://farm4.static.flickr.com/3627/3605878050_cc66835d9f_t.jpg" border="0" alt="nettysworld" align="left" />If you have, or know, very young children, check out this website designed for kids ages 2-7.  The Australian site, <a href="http://rs6.net/tn.jsp?et=1102595060648&amp;s=241&amp;e=001BmQfbIl9axdrUtpHug0H3m3pHIvqkBWPxxUiTzyAylv1FBOJ0f2qpynY-YIFLLzi3EJRiqcAsFDnwhSbCS8kpJiJI-JpwkLVwFvlx3EdAplYh3ZQ6SzRZA==" target="_blank"><span style="color: #000099;">Nettysworld.com</span></a>, allows kids to play games that focus on how to use the Internet safely.  There are about five or six adventures that children can choose:  making friends, exploring the net, getting things off the net, staying safe on the net, even using smart phones.  There&#8217;s a section for parents that encourages them to play the games along with the children and talk with them about using the Internet.  This seems like a really great idea, especially for the youngest Internet adventurers.<br />

<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;">Brooklyn</span><span style="font-size: 12pt;">, New York</span><span style="font-size: 12pt;">: The LAMP (Learning About Multimedia Project) launched the first volume in its LAMPlit series of multimedia resource guides, entitled “LAMPlit: A Beginner’s Guide to Going Online.”<span> </span></span><span style="font-size: 12pt;">All of the guides in the LAMPlit series will be available for free download from the LAMP’s website at <a href="http://www.thelampnyc.org/lamplit/" target="_blank"><span style="text-decoration: underline;">www.thelampnyc.org</span>/lamplit</a></span>.<span> </span><span style="font-size: 12pt;">The guides are written and disseminated by the LAMP without corporate sponsorship.</span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;"> </span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;">The first guide focuses on helping adults and young people have a safe and positive experience online, and is released in coincidence with National Cyber Safety Awareness Month.<span> </span>During Symantec’s Norton Online Living Report in 2007, 1 in 5 children reported doing things online that their parents would disapprove of, while only 50% of parents have spoken to their kids about practicing safe online habits.<span> </span>One reason parents may be hesitant to get involved is because parents tend to hear more about the bad things that can happen online, says LAMP Executive Director D.C. Vito.</span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;"> </span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;">“The stories about online predators and cyberbullying tend to be the ones that get the most coverage,” says Mr. Vito.<span> </span>“It creates a culture of fear around the Internet and new media, and we’ve seen a lot of emphasis on the negative.<span> </span>We wanted to create a guide that is balanced and fair, that does not deny any of the bad things that potentially can happen online, but that also hits on the ways that the Internet is really a great thing.<span> </span>People just have to know what they’re doing.” </span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;"> </span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;">In addition to addressing privacy concerns, LAMPlit also aims to support parents who might avoid getting involved in their children’s online activities because new media can be overwhelming.</span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;"> </span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;">“It can be difficult for parents to start a conversation with their kids about what they’re doing online, but it’s absolutely imperative,” says Katherine Fry, Ph.D., Associate Professor of Media Studies at Brooklyn  College and Education Director for the LAMP.<span> </span>“Too often, adults are intimidated by new technology, so they just ignore it.<span> </span>They miss using media as a chance to bring their family closer together instead of farther apart.”</span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;"> </span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;">All of the guides in the LAMPlit series will be available for free download from the LAMP’s website at <a href="http://www.thelampnyc.org/lamplit/">www.thelampnyc.org/lamplit</a>.Future LAMPlit guides will target gaming, social networking, Internet ethics, news, advertising and more.</span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;"> </span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;">About The LAMP:</span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><span style="font-size: 12pt;">The Learning About Multimedia Project (The LAMP) is a non-profit organization which strives to provide critical media literacy skills to the inter-related groups of youths, their parents and educators throughout New   York City.<span> </span>Free media education workshops and events offered by the LAMP demystify the constant flow of media these three groups encounter, bridge the digital divide, and provide workforce development skills for future generations.</span></p>
